Course Details
• Fixture Design Fundamentals: Understanding the basics of fixture design, including materials, geometry, and loading conditions. • Reliability Engineering Principles: An overview of reliability engineering, including key concepts such as failure rates, mean time between failures (MTBF), and reliability growth. • Fixture Design for Reliability: Best practices for designing fixtures to maximize reliability, including considerations for fatigue, corrosion, and wear. • Reliability Testing and Analysis: Techniques for testing the reliability of fixtures, including accelerated testing, statistical analysis, and reliability prediction. • Fixture Maintenance and Repair: Strategies for maintaining and repairing fixtures to ensure long-term reliability, including preventive maintenance, predictive maintenance, and condition-based monitoring. • Quality Management Systems: An overview of quality management systems, including ISO 9001 and related standards, and their application to fixture design and reliability. • Risk Management in Fixture Design: Techniques for identifying and mitigating risks in fixture design, including failure modes and effects analysis (FMEA) and fault tree analysis (FTA). • Design for Manufacturing and Assembly (DFMA): Principles and practices for designing fixtures to facilitate manufacturing and assembly, including modularity, standardization, and simplification.
